Right, I'm finally going to get the Redsnapper Tripod from Joe and also one of his heads, my question is:
For landscape pics where I will be carrying the kit up mountains which head would people recommend ?:help:
 
Ball. I have a pistol grip (Manfrotto 322RC2) And while its good and easy to use, its not ideal. It doesn't allow to to lock it open so you can't use it for panning or wildlife really. Also it makes shifting from landscape to portrait orientation hard and slightly unstable. What's your budget for the head? I would suggest some sort of Arca compatible ball head.
 
I only have about £100 for the tripod and head together, which is why I was looking at REDSNAPPER.
 
If you're lugging a tripod up a mountain I would go for the ball head as it will probably be more convenient to carry.

A useful (and cheap) addition to your camera accessories would also be a hotshoe spirit level
